After Detective Dee (played by Zhao Youting) successfully solves the case of the Dragon King of the Capital, Emperor Gaozong (played by Sheng Jian) grants him the divine artifact, the Kanglong Mace. However, he faces jealousy from Empress Wu Zetian (played by Lau Kar-ling). The Empress plots to steal the Kanglong Mace and sets up Detective Dee by gathering a group of skilled practitioners known as the "Anomalous Group," assigning Yuchi Zhenjin (played by Feng Shaofeng) to lead them. With the assistance of the medical officer Shatuo Zhong (played by Lin Gengxin), Detective Dee successfully escapes the persecution of the "Anomalous Group" and discusses a reconciliation with Yuchi Zhenjin. Meanwhile, the assassin Shuiyue (played by Ma Sichun) from the "Anomalous Group" discovers that an unknown force has emerged in the capital. As Detective Dee navigates Wu Zetian's traps, the Tang Dynasty falls into a deeper crisis. The "Demon Suppression Clan" appears with their extraordinary abilities, leading to an impending "Demon Slaughter" war...
